Program for the Orientation Day - Spring 2012

Sist oppdatert 27.01.2012 av Maija Heinilä

Welcome to Vestfold University College and Norway! We are looking forward to meeting you. Kindly remember to take your Erasmus documents with you for signing.

The Orientation Day, 1st of February, 2012

 Room: C2-80, Campus Bakkenteigen

Program

09:00                    Meet by the main reception (main entrance) at Campus Bakkenteigen

09:10 - 09:30       Welcome by Vice Rector Anne Fængsrud 

09:30 – 09:45      Introduction to the student services available to international students  

  • Health Services
  • Social guidance
  • International Coordinators
  • International Office
  • Student Services
  • SIV

09:45 – 10:15      Norwegian culture

10:15 - 10:45      Erasmus documents- signing and a coffee break

10:45-11:30        Practical matters, banking, mobile phones, transportation, food

11:30-12:30        Lunch at Alimento

12:30 -13:30      Room C2-95 Registration, ID-cards, student buddies
